Affordable daycare is actually a pressing issue for families in the united states, given that cost of childcare continues to increase. With more moms and dads going into the staff and requiring trustworthy take care of their children, the availability of inexpensive daycare is a crucial aspect in determining the economic security of many people. This observational study aims to explore the effect of affordable daycare on people, focusing on the benefits and challenges that include use of quality, affordable childcare.
Methodology
With this study, observational study practices had been employed to gather data in the experiences of people with inexpensive daycare. A sample of 50 households was chosen from different socio-economic backgrounds, with a variety of childcare needs and tastes. Participants were interviewed about their particular experiences with inexpensive daycare, such as the costs, quality of attention, and general impact on their family characteristics. Findings were also made at daycare facilities to assess the standard of treatment provided while the communications between young ones, caregivers, and moms and dads.
Results
The outcome of this study revealed a variety of advantages and difficulties involving affordable daycare. People reported that use of inexpensive childcare permitted all of them to work full-time, go after advanced schooling, and take in additional responsibilities without worrying about the price of treatment. Many moms and dads additionally noted that kids benefited from socialization and educational options given by daycare facilities, which aided them develop crucial skills and prepare for college.
However, challenges were additionally reported, including restricted option of inexpensive daycare in certain places, long waitlists for quality services, and concerns towards quality of treatment provided. Some people noted which they must make sacrifices in other regions of their spending plan to cover childcare, while some expressed disappointment using the lack of flexibility in daycare hours and/or not enough social or language-specific programs with their kiddies.
Overall, the influence of affordable daycare on people was mainly positive, with several moms and dads articulating gratitude the assistance and sources provided by childcare facilities. However, there's nonetheless a necessity for more affordable options and greater availability for people needing quality look after kids.
